Origin Version (Select Help-->About Origin): 7.5
Operating System:win-XP

I would like to make color contour graph.
So far, I used Matrix convert for contour plot with same X-axis value.
But each data have different X-axis range with same data points as following picture.and how to make 3-D plot and 2D color contour plot?
For example, fist data have 1 to 10 X-axis value with 1000 data point.
Second have 2 to 9.2 X-axis value with 1000data.
Third has 3 to 7.5 X-axis value with 1000 data.. and so on.

Would you let me know how to make 3-D plot and 2D color contour plot?
